Output 95658e0d92ca4514cba6cb5cc395087e4f6281d3fae5114ca9b8fd75d6e766e5:0

value
1548218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05bba73dc25f73f40d6323a59788245c5a1b2ce0 OP_EQUAL
address
32DL6t6eA1SSrWmFsvKVa9Hr1f6Z27Pdpg
transaction
95658e0d92ca4514cba6cb5cc395087e4f6281d3fae5114ca9b8fd75d6e766e5
spent
true